A linear motion actuator is defined as a device that converts various forms of energy into linear motion or straight push/pull movements. Actuators (electric cylinders) are mainly thrust producing devices that use either an acme or ball screw as the driving mechanism.

Linear Actuators we Carry

Rod Actuators

Rod type actuators produce more force and are highly tolerant of dirty environments, although they require a bearing structure to carry the load. The thrust element or rod moves out of the end of the actuator as motion takes place.

In this actuator, the actuator housing completely surrounds the screw, which provides a load bearing and guidance structure. Rodless actuators carry the load without the need for external guides and are particularly suited for transporting loads at long stroke lengths. Rodless actuators are difficult to seal and thus are not ideal for dirty or wet environments.

球螺钉执行器

Ball screw actuators are essentially lead screw actuators that use ball bearings. They are usually chosen due to their faster rates of speed with continuous duty cycles and ability to carry higher loads. They are more expensive but offer less friction when compared to lead screw actuators.

Belt Actuators

Belt actuators are actuators based on belt drives and are often used where speed is important but with limited accuracy. These actuators operate under the same principle as the conveyor belt system; the belt drive translates rotary motion to linear motion via a timing belt. Belt actuators are designed for high speeds with long distances and are perfect for fast positioning and handling tasks

Integrated Actuators

Integrated actuators, as the name suggests, integrate a rod style actuator into a motor housing to eliminate the need for coupling. These actuators provide the lowest size and weight with easier maintenance, but at a higher cost.
